點擊查看:2018年3月計算機二級Web考試練習題及答案匯總
1. JavaBean的具體類可以不是public的。 (錯)
2. JavaBean可以只提供一個帶參數的構造器。 (錯)
3.jsp:userBean可以向HTML標記一樣不關閉。 (錯)
4.JavaBean可以保存狀態。 (對)
5.Servlet的生命周期分三個時期:init 、service 、destroy 。 (對)
6.Page對象代表JSP頁面對應的Servlet類實例。 (對)
7.在JSP文件中引用Bean,其實就是用語句。 (錯)
8.Bean文件放在任何目錄下都可以被引用。 (錯)
9.Java文件與Bean所定義的類名可以不同,但一定要注意區分字母的大小寫。 (對)
10.可以在一個頁面中使用多個指令。 (對)
簡述JSP的執行過程?
客戶端發出Request(請求)
JSP Container將JSP轉譯成Servlet的源代碼
將產生的Servlet的源代碼經過編譯后,并加載到內存執行
把結果Response(響應)至客戶端
當服務器啟動后,當WEB瀏覽器端發送過來一個頁面請求時,WEB服務器先判斷是不否是JSP頁面請求。如果該頁面只是一般的HTML/XML頁面請求,則直接將頁面代碼傳給WEB瀏覽器端.如果請求的頁面是JSP頁面,則由JSP引擎檢查該JSP頁面,如果該頁面是第一次被請求、或不是第一次被請求但已修改,則JSP引擎將此JSP頁面代碼轉換成Servlet代碼,然后JSP引擎調用服務器端的Java編譯器javac.exe對Servlet代碼進行編譯,把它變成字節碼(.class)文件,然后再調用Java虛擬機執行該字節碼文件,然后將執行結果傳給WEB瀏覽器端。如果該JSP頁面不是第一次被請求,且沒有被修改過,則直接由JSP引擎調用Java虛擬機執行已編譯過的字節碼class文件,然后將結果傳送WEB瀏覽器端。
微信搜索"考試吧"了解更多考試資訊、下載備考資料
相關推薦: